The VOW to Hire Heroes Act of 2011 also provides seamless transition for Servicemembers, expands education and training opportunities for Veterans, and provides tax credits for employers who hire Veterans with service-connected disabilities. VRAP offers 12 months of training assistance to Veterans who are at least 35, but no more than 60 years old; are unemployed; received an other than dishonorable discharge; are not eligible for any other VA education benefit program (e.g., the Post-9/11 GI Bill, Montgomery GI Bill, Vocational Rehabilitation and Employment Assistance); are not in receipt of VA compensation due to unemployability; and are not enrolled in a Federal or state job-training program.
